Merge branch 'master' of https://gitlab.denx.de/u-boot/custodians/u-boot-spi
[platform/kernel/u-boot.git] / .travis.yml
index e6db9d6..c59bd77 100644 (file)
@@ -22,6 +22,7 @@ addons:
     - libsdl2-dev
     - python
     - python-pyelftools
+    - python3-sphinx
     - python3-virtualenv
     - python3-pip
     - swig
@@ -38,6 +39,7 @@ addons:
     - libisl15
     - clang-7
     - srecord
+    - graphviz
 
 install:
  # Clone uboot-test-hooks
@@ -246,7 +248,7 @@ matrix:
         - BUILDMAN="sun50i -x orangepi"
     - name: "buildman catch-all ARM"
       env:
-        - BUILDMAN="arm -x arm11,arm7,arm9,aarch64,at91,bcm,freescale,kirkwood,mvebu,siemens,tegra,uniphier,mx,samsung,sunxi,am33xx,omap,rockchip,toradex,socfpga,k2,k3,zynq"
+        - BUILDMAN="arm -x arm11,arm7,arm9,aarch64,at91,bcm,freescale,kirkwood,mvebu,siemens,tegra,uniphier,mx,samsung,sunxi,am33xx,omap,rk,toradex,socfpga,k2,k3,zynq"
     - name: "buildman sandbox x86"
       env:
         - BUILDMAN="sandbox x86"
@@ -320,10 +322,10 @@ matrix:
         - BUILDMAN="uniphier"
     - name: "buildman catch-all AArch64"
       env:
-        - BUILDMAN="aarch64 -x bcm,k3,tegra,ls1,ls2,mvebu,uniphier,sunxi,samsung,rockchip,versal,zynq"
+        - BUILDMAN="aarch64 -x bcm,k3,tegra,ls1,ls2,lx216,mvebu,uniphier,sunxi,samsung,socfpga,rk,versal,zynq"
     - name: "buildman rockchip"
       env:
-        - BUILDMAN="rockchip -x orangepi"
+        - BUILDMAN="rk -x orangepi"
     - name: "buildman sh"
       env:
         - BUILDMAN="sh -x arm"
@@ -352,6 +354,10 @@ matrix:
     - name: "cppcheck"
       script:
         - cppcheck --force --quiet --inline-suppr .
+    # build HTML documentation
+    - name: "htmldocs"
+      script:
+        - make htmldocs
     # search for TODO within source tree
     - name: "grep TODO"
       script: